Sway Prototypes - Volume 2 --- 2019-07-05

Sway is an interactive live electronic processing environment for any number of musicians. Development of this work started in mid-2017 and is in constant development. This volume series presents the various performances using Sway in a variety of contexts. Emergence was recorded on 9 October 2018 at Firehouse 12, New Haven, CT by Greg DiCrosta. Bloom was recorded on 17 October 2018 at Best Video, Hamden, CT by Hank Hoffman and Carl Testa as part of the 2018 New Haven Noise Festival. Special Thanks to Conor Perreault.
